Jonathon Millmow (Wellington B) becomes the third of Andrew Hintz’s five victims, bowled for 21, in the national second Xis cricket match between Canterbury and Wellington at Hagley Oval yesterday. Peter Rattray is at slip and Kevin Congdon is under the helmet.
